Show May 31 2001 County Chronicle Progress 10 Millard Page Notice Dennis Hinkamp Most pruning equipment is bought used a couple of times then left to rust in the garage or used to trim the dog's toenails The reason most often is that the vnong tool as purchased in the first place So what pruning equipment do you really need for your yard and landscape? "There seems to be as many different pruning tools as there are plants to be pruned" says Jerry Goodspeed Utah State University Extension horticulturist "You arrive at the store to buy a simple pruner only to be bombarded with choosing from a wall full of everything from bow saws to motorized pole pruncrs The temptation is to buy anything that is on sale and hope it does the job Withstand this temptation The most common pruning tool is a hand pruner Goodspeed says It is used forcutting perennials and any woody stem that is less than the width of your thumb for this job choose bypass pruners over the anvil type A sharp bypass pruner is less damaging to the stem being cut and is easier to maintain A good hand pruner may cost between S25 and $45 but they will last for up to 15 years For pruning wood about the diameter of a good shovel handle buy a dependable pair of bypass loppers he suggests Again avoid the anvil type They hav e a tendency to smash the wood and not cut the limb nice and clean The loppers are especially useful because they give leverage "A good pair of loppers can cost tween S45 and S75” Goodspeed says "I use my loppers more than any other prunfeel it's critical
